I've a question about de 8 by 8 tiles strategie, becouse i don't can find a
proper way to use it, everytime i've made a square of 8 * 8 with roads on it
and i develop it with medium or high density residential or commercial, than
the 4 tiles in the middle gives me de no road sign, en there will be never
build.....

My city is now over 60 years old en has about 45.000 people in it.

Wat am i doing wrong ????

I think your problem stems from not having enough demand for the larger
buildings - try bulldozing an entire block and see what re-develops there. I
figure at the moment you only have buildings 2-3 squares large at most, am I
correct? Also, make sure water is connected and desirability is up. Failing
that build smaller tile areas Razz

I'm not sure how it is with SC4K, but in SC3K: Residential would
build to 4 squares from the road, commercial 3, industrial 5.
Depanding upaon demand, the ones closer to the road build first.
Also there are things that will allow deeper development.

In SC4K, when you lay out zones, you get an indication of how the lot will
lay and in what direction the driveway will sit. Each lot needs to be
touching a road or street. Personally I think we should have more control
over how lots are laid out, but there seems to be no way to control that.
Some residential lots are 1 x 2, some are 1 x 3, some are 2 x 2. You can
also force some layouts by plopping down 1 x 1 lots, but I'm not sure if
that negatively affects the game or not. I like to try to make that a low
income part of town.
